Around 40 pain physicians urged the public to know more about chronic pain and minimally invasive treatments. This call was made at a meeting in Hyderabad, organized by the Telangana chapter of Society for the Study of Pain. The event was part of Pain Awareness Month observed in September 2026. Chronic pain, lasting over three months, affects various parts like bones and nerves. Doctors stressed that this persistent pain impacts mobility and mental well-being. π©Ί
